About the course
This double degree combines professional communication with an accredited law (honours) qualification. You study communication and law units concurrently, building skills in public relations, media and stakeholder communication alongside legal reasoning, research and advocacy. The program includes a communication major plus the full law core, electives and QUT You units, with later years focused more heavily on law. Career outcome
Graduates can pursue roles that connect law, public affairs and strategic communication across government, corporates, NGOs and consultancies. Career paths may include legal practice (subject to admission requirements), policy and regulatory roles, compliance, risk and governance, and communications/public relations positions such as media relations, corporate communications or stakeholder engagement. The combination supports work in complex, highly regulated environments. This is a Bachelor/Honours pathway in law and public relations.
